They can help you maximize Your Settlement

The value of a settlement in an accident with a truck is determined by the cost of your medical bills, loss of income, and pain and discomfort. It also is contingent on the extent of your injuries. If you have sustained severe injuries, it's likely that you'll need surgery and ongoing therapy. These costs can mount up quickly, even with medical insurance. You should keep track of all your expenses as well as medical records to prove the amount you've actually lost.

Local lawyers can help understand your rights, case value, and work with insurance companies to settle your claim. They can also negotiate with trucking companies as well as private insurers to get larger settlements.

Often, big truck accidents trigger serious chain-reaction collisions, and the impacted parties typically have multiple policies to cover their losses. Local lawyers know the aspects of the insurance system for commercial businesses and how to gather crucial evidence such as witness statements trucker logs and crash scene photos to maximize your compensation.

You can protect your rights

Large truck accidents can be more complicated than car accidents, as there are many parties who could be accountable for the accident. It is crucial to have a truck accident lawyer by your side. This includes the driver as well as the trucking company, third party brokers, as well the manufacturer. Your lawyer will investigate any possible liable parties to ensure you are compensated for your injuries.

Truck drivers could be held liable for an accident in the event that they don't follow traffic laws and drive while texting or using their mobile phone in any manner or while under the influence of controlled substances or when fatigued, or if they do not perform regular maintenance on their trucks. Trucking companies could be held liable if hire unqualified drivers, pressure drivers to speed up or work longer hours than is permitted by law, or if they provide inadequate training to new drivers.

The manufacturer of a semi-truck can be held accountable if the truck is not properly created, manufactured, or built. Trucks that have a tendency to rollovers or have other dangerous issues may be included. It could also include parts that are improperly constructed or designed including brakes that are not working properly. Semi-trucks are constructed and designed in accordance with federal safety standards. A lawyer for truck accidents who is knowledgeable about the laws can apply it in your case.
